In triangle abc, m of acb = 90, cd is perpendicular to ab , m of acd is 60. and bd is 5 cm. find ad
weeeeeb [17]

Let us draw a picture to make the things more clear.

Attached is the image.

We have been given that

\angle acd = 60 ^{\circ}

Therefore, we have

\angle dcb =90- 60= 30 ^{\circ}

Now, in triangle bcd, we have

\tan30 = \frac{5}{cd}\\
\\
\frac{1}{\sqrt 3}=\frac{5}{cd}\\
\\
cd=5\sqrt 3

Now, in triangle acb, we have

tan 60 = \frac{ad}{5\sqrt3} \\
\\
\sqrt 3=  \frac{ad}{5\sqrt3}\\
\\
ad= 5\sqrt3 \times \sqrt 3\\
\\
ad= 5\times 3\\
\\
ad=15

Thus, ad is 15 cm.

Please help me solve this!!
Mice21 [21]

Answer:

Abelito had the greater average speed

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Bobby:

Distance =4\ miles

Time = 30\ minutes

Abelito

Distance = 10\ miles

Time = 48\ minutes

Required:

Who had a greater average speed

Average speed (S) is calculated as:

S = \frac{Distance}{Time}

We will make use of mph (miles per hour) as the unit of speed.

For Bobby:

S_B = \frac{4\ miles}{30\ minutes}

Convert minute to hour

S_B = \frac{4\ miles}{0.5\ hr}

S_B = 8mph

For Abelito

S_A = \frac{10\ miles}{48\ minutes}

Convert minute to hour

S_A = \frac{10\ miles}{0.8\ hr}

S_A = 12.5mph

By comparison: 12.5mph > 8mph

Hence: Abelito had the greater average speed
